Abstract
The utility model relates to a drilling floor surface buffering device and is characterized by the inclusion of a framework and a plurality of crossers, wherein the crossers are paved in parallel in the framework made of angle steel; hoisting lug plates are arranged at the periphery of the framework; and fixing steel plates are arranged on the framework at the bottoms of the crossers. Compared with the prior art, the drilling floor surface buffering device has the benefits that: bolts are not required to fix the drilling floor surface buffering device, the drilling floor surface buffering device is independent of a drilling floor, and the crossers are fixed only by the frictions among the crossers and the framework and among the crossers; when used, the drilling floor surface buffering device can be put anywhere as required by working, and during the replacement of the drilling floor surface buffering device, working on the drilling floor surface is not required to be stopped, so that a large amount of working time is saved, the working efficiency is improved and the drilling floor surface buffering device is more convenient and reliable to use.
Description
Technical field
The utility model relates to a kind of rig floor face buffer that is used for petroleum well servicing rig.
Background technology
In the petroleum well servicing rig operation process, the mentioning and all can cushion when putting down and moving the equipment of various vulnerable equipments and fragile rig floor face of drilling rod by means of the chock on the rig floor face, so the chock on the rig floor face is changed frequent.Traditional rig floor face buffer is that chock is directly installed on the rig floor face by being threaded.During replacing, for safety not only will stop work on the rig floor face, and, because the liftoff higher appearance and size of rig floor face is bigger, cause dismounting chock operation inconvenience, waste a large amount of time and manpower, operating efficiency is low.
Summary of the invention
The purpose of this utility model provides a kind of rig floor face buffer, changes fast, and easy to operate, applicability is strong.
For solving the problems of the technologies described above, the technical solution of the utility model is:
Rig floor face buffer is characterized in that, comprises framework, chock, and many chock parallel laid are in angle steel system framework, and frame perimeter has been provided with shackle plate.
Described chock under(-)chassis is provided with fixation steel plate.
Compared with prior art, the beneficial effects of the utility model are: this device does not need bolton, be independent of outside the rig floor, only by between chock and the framework and the fixing chock of the frictional force between chock and the chock, during use, this device can be placed on the optional position of need of work, need not to stop the work on the rig floor face during replacing, not only save the extensive work time and improved operating efficiency, also more safe and reliable during use.
Description of drawings
Fig. 1 is the utility model example structure schematic diagram;
Fig. 2 is the vertical view of Fig. 1.
Among the figure: 1-framework 2-fixation steel plate 3-chock 4-plays shackle plate
The specific embodiment
Below in conjunction with accompanying drawing the specific embodiment of the present utility model is described further:
Seeing Fig. 1, Fig. 2, is the utility model rig floor face buffer example structure schematic diagram, comprises framework 1, chock 3, and many chock 3 parallel laid are in angle steel system framework 1, and framework 1 periphery has been provided with shackle plate 4.Also be provided with fixation steel plate 2 on chock 3 under(-)chassiss 1, be used for improving the intensity of framework 1.
During use, hung on the shackle plate 4 with wire rope, the buffer of slinging is put into any operating position on the rig floor face, does not need bolton, fixes by the frictional force of device and rig floor face, and is convenient to operation.Can hang the rig floor face when changing chock 3, both improve operating efficiency, also more safe and reliable during use.
